Prince Harry, who craves privacy, to live-stream intimate conversation with 'trauma expert'

As Twitchy reported, “South Park” absolutely destroyed Prince Harry and Meghan Markle so thoroughly in a recent episode that GB News reported that the couple’s lawyers were “casting an eye” on the episode.

Advertisement

“South Park has taken multiple shots at Meghan Markle and Prince Harry mocking their claims they want privacy despite signing lucrative deals with Netflix and Spotify to publish content about their lives,” reported GB News. It’s not just “South Park,” though — a lot of us have taken shots at Harry and Meghan crying about their privacy while Netflix pays them to air a documentary about them.

Now we’re hearing that Harry will sit down with a “trauma expert” to discuss his personal traumas as well as the importance of personal healing. Oh, and live-stream the whole thing.

Isabel Keane reports:

Prince Harry is set to unpack his experiences with a controversial trauma expert on Saturday, during a virtual event in which attendees can submit questions for the former royal to answer.

Harry, whose memoir “Spare” topped bestseller charts, will join Canadian doctor and author Gabor Maté for an “intimate conversation,” to which royal fans can purchase tickets for $33.99, publisher Random House said in a statement about the event.

In an email to Postmedia, Maté, a bestselling author whose books have been published in over 30 languages, said their conversation would be about the impact of emotional loss and the importance of personal healing.
